Economic Impact and Legislative Responses

Republican senators are vocalizing worries about the economic repercussions of 's tariffs, citing issues like manufacturers' planning difficulties, farmers facing Chinese retaliation, and rising household prices.

In response to growing concerns, seven Republican senators have co-sponsored a bill requiring presidential tariff actions to be pre-approved by , highlighting a significant divide within the over Trump's tariff policy.

Tariff Strategy and Trade Negotiations

Senators express frustration over the lack of a clear timeline for trade negotiations, emphasizing the immediate burden of high tariffs on consumers and the potential for an inflationary effect and trade wars.

Despite criticism, some Republican senators remain hopeful that Trump's tariff strategy, coupled with ongoing negotiations, could ultimately benefit the U.S. economy, though they demand more transparency and accountability.
